Harvey Clay Nesbit Park spans 40 acres in the northwest corner of town. This park features baseball and softball fields, access to the Twelve Mile Creek Trail, and picnic tables. It sits next to Kensington Elementary School and the Millbridge neighborhood.

What are some of the longer, more challenging road cycling routes in the area?

For a longer and more challenging ride, consider the Harvey Clay Nesbit Park loop from Long Branch. This moderate 53.2-mile path features significant climbing with over 2,100 feet of elevation gain, passing through scenic parklands. Another option is the Seaboard Train in Matthews loop from Island, a 47.4-mile route with over 1,400 feet of elevation gain.
